Victorian Slide Bracelet Double Row Multi-Gem 14K

This is a spectacular estate fine! It is a 14 karat yellow gold Victorian Slide bracelet with double rows. The bracelet features 20 slides crafted from 14 karat yellow gold and set with variety of stones, including, pearls & turquoise, garnets, black star sapphires, blue sapphires, cameos, tiger's eye, abalone, a golden dragon with a diamond, and a golden dragon without a diamond. The clasp is an exquisite enamel portrait of a blonde woman in a blue foil dress with a midnight blue background. The clasp is approximately 1" x 1" and is a hidden box clasp. The slides move on fine 14 karat gold link chains. The bracelet is approximately 7" long and has a safety chain. The separating beads are approximately 3.5 mm. The bracelet weighs 68.2 grams (43.9dwt). The bracelet is in amazing condition, considering it is likely over 100 years old. So hard to find anymore. There are some missing turquoise from around the pearls. A diamond appears to be missing from one of the dragon slides. Don't let this beauty slide though your fingers!
